Case Name : Tajunissa Vs Mr. Vishal Sharma (Delhi High Court)

Tajunissa Vs Mr. Vishal Sharma (Delhi High Court) Statutory proscription engrafted in Section 34 of the SARFAESI Act, therefore, the Supreme Court has, in the afore-extracted passage from Mardia Chemicals, chiseled out an exception, in a case in which for example, the action of the secured creditor is alleged to be fraudulent or his claim may be so absurd and untenable which may not require any probe whatsoever.
